InteractiveAg - Data Use Policy


Effective Date: 1/1/2025


This Data Use Policy explains how InteractiveAg, LLC("InteractiveAg," "we," "us," or "our"), a company based in Indiana, collects, uses, protects, and shares the data you generate and provide through the InteractiveAg mobile application, website, and related services (the "Service").

  

1. 🌾 Principles of Data Stewardship

InteractiveAg’s data policy is guided by the following principles:

  • Farmer  Owns the Data: You, the farmer, own the raw data generated by your      farming operations and input into the Service.
  • Transparency and Control: We will be clear about what data we collect and how we      use it, and you will have control over sharing and deletion.
  • Security: We commit to implementing reasonable security measures to protect your data.
  • No Commercial Sale of Individual Data: We do not sell your Individual Farm Data to third parties without your explicit, written consent.

  

2. 💾 Data We Collect

We collect data necessary to provide and improve the Service, which falls into three main categories:

 

Individual Farm Data (Ag Data): Specific, raw data directly related to your farming operation and tied to your identity. You own this data.


Personal Data: Information that identifies you as an individual farmer or   farm representative (example: Name, email address, phone number, physical address, billing information, account login credentials)

 

Usage Data: Non-identifiable data about how the Service is accessed and used (Example: 

App crash reports, pages viewed, features used, login times, device type)

  

3. 🎯 How We Use Your Data

InteractiveAg uses your data only for the purposes explicitly stated below:

3.1 Use of Individual Farm Data (Ag Data)

We use your Individual Farm Data for the following purposes directly related to providing you the Service:

  • To generate Farm Analytics, Reports, and Recommendations specific to your grain marketing (e.g., basis, futures, etc).
  • To provide Operational Tools such as financial assessment and management.
  • To facilitate Data Portability and Integration with other authorized third-party services you select.
  • To Troubleshoot, Debug, and Improve the core functionality of the Service.

3.2 Use of Aggregated and Anonymized Data (De-Identified Data)

We may convert your Individual Farm Data into Aggregated and Anonymized Data (data that is stripped of all personally identifiable information and combined with data from many other users so that it cannot be reasonably linked back to you or your specific farm).

We may use this Aggregated and Anonymized Data for:

  • Product Improvement: To improve our algorithms and build new Service features.
  • Research & Benchmarking: To provide general market analysis, benchmark      reports, and industry insights.
  • Commercial Use: To sell or license generalized industry data to third parties      (e.g., researchers, manufacturers, commodity traders). This data will never identify you or your farm individually.

3.3 Use of Personal Data (PII)

We use your Personal Data to:

  • Manage your Account and Billing.
  • Communicate with you regarding service updates, technical support, security      alerts, and changes to our policies.
  • Comply with Legal Obligations (e.g., responding to court orders).

  

4. 🔗 Sharing and Disclosure of Your Data

We will not sell, rent, or lease your Individual Farm Data or Personal Data to third parties for marketing purposes. Data is only shared under the following conditions:

4.1 With Your Explicit Consent (Data Sharing)

We will share your Individual Farm Data with third parties (e.g., your agronomist, equipment dealer, crop insurer, or other technology platforms) only after you provide explicit, revocable consent through the Service. You control the scope and duration of this access.

4.2 With Our Service Providers (Data Processing)

We use third-party service providers (e.g., cloud hosting, payment processing) to operate the Service. These partners are required to use the data only on our behalf and are prohibited from using your data for any other purpose.

4.3 Legal Requirements

We may disclose your data if required by law or in response to a valid legal process, such as a subpoena, search warrant, or court order. In such cases, and where legally permissible, we will make reasonable efforts to notify you before disclosing your Individual Farm Data.

  

5. 🔒 Data Security and Retention

5.1 Security Measures

We implement reasonable administrative, technical, and physical security practices appropriate to the volume and nature of the data we process, including data encryption, access control mechanisms, and regular security audits. However, no internet transmission or electronic storage is 100% secure.

5.2 Data Retention and Deletion (Your Right to Delete)

  • Retention: We retain your Individual Farm Data and Personal Data only as long as your account is active or as necessary to provide the Service, resolve disputes, or comply with our legal obligations.
  • Deletion: Upon termination of your account, you have the right to request the      deletion of your Individual Farm Data and Personal Data. We will fulfill this request within a reasonable timeframe, subject to our right to retain Aggregated and Anonymized Data and any data required for legal or auditing purposes.

  

6. ⚖️ Your Rights and Control (Indiana CDPA)

If the volume of data we process meets the thresholds of the Indiana Consumer Data Protection Act (ICDPA), you may have the following rights, which we will uphold:

  • Right to Access: You can request confirmation of whether we are processing your personal data and access to that data.
  • Right to Correct: You can request the correction of inaccuracies in your      personal data.
  • Right to Delete: You can request the deletion of your personal data and      Individual Farm Data.
  • Right to Data Portability: You can request a copy of your Individual Farm Data in a common, machine-readable format.

To exercise any of these rights, please contact us using the information in Section 7. We will respond to authenticated requests within the timeframe required by Indiana law.
